Java - Tablas java

   
Vista:

Tablas java

Publicado por Sergio (3 intervenciones) el 10/12/2010 18:40:52
El problema es que tengo que hacer un ejercicio en java que me indique TODOs los elementos de una tabla que pasen de 27..

Mi idea es esta pero no sale bien y no entiendo el porque:

while(index < lasEstaciones.length-1 && !encontrado){
index = index + 1;
encontrado = (lasDiurnasJueves[index]>27);
}

if (encontrado) {
System.out.println("* " + lasEstaciones[index] + " (" + lasDiurnasJueves[index] + " graus).");


if (index < lasEstaciones.length-1 && !encontrado){
index = index + 1;
encontrado = (asDiurnasJueves[index]>27);


System.out.println("* " + lasEstaciones[index] + " (" + lasDiurnasJueves[index] + " graus).");

}
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Tablas java

Publicado por Tom (912 intervenciones) el 11/12/2010 03:55:31
Parece un acertijo. ¿Qué es exactamente eso de "no sale bien"?

Por si acaso, prueba algo como:

for(i = 0; (i < cosa.length) && (cosa[i] < 28); i++);
if(index < cosa.length) {
System.out.println("Viva, viva!! acerté !: " + cosa[i] + " es mayor que 27");
}
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Tablas java

Publicado por Sergio (3 intervenciones) el 12/12/2010 17:52:15
no puedo utilitzar for!! solo puedo utilizar while
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Tablas java

Publicado por Sergio (3 intervenciones) el 12/12/2010 18:01:53
y igualmente con el for no funciona!
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ar